Easy to maneuver

A pushchair is an infant-carrying vehicle with four wheels designed for older children and toddlers. It can be rear-facing or forward-facing and is usually folded and collapsible for simple transportation in the back of a car or on public transport. A pushchair can also be called a stroller.

There are a variety of pushchairs on the market. Some pushchairs have three wheels, which makes them more mobile. Others have four wheels and are sturdy. Some have swivel tires that allow you to turn the buggy easily in tight areas, such as shopping aisles. Some have all-terrain tires that can handle bumps and holes on the road.

If you're in search of a pushchair that is easy to maneuver, check out online reviews to see how it is easy to steer and control. Pay attention to comments about how well the stroller handles curbs and busy streets. This is an important element of a great stroller.

You should also check how much weight the pushchair is carrying. Some are extremely heavy, so you might want to choose an option that is lighter and more easy to climb up the stairs or carry the steps into your first-floor flat.

A pushchair should be comfortable for both parents and children. For a more comfortable ride for your child, opt for models with padded straps and soft seat upholstery. The pushchair should also have an ample storage basket. Some pushchairs have additional features, such as a parasol or rain cover. Consider a convertible pushchair that can grow with your baby and provides a variety of seating options.

Comfortable

A comfortable pushchair allows you to spend more time with your child. Find models with a soft, cushioned seat with reclining options that can keep your child comfortable. The best pushchairs have cup holders and a footmuff along with rain covers. These features increase their comfort. Some models come with an integrated baby hood, which is useful in unpredictable British weather.

A well-designed pushchair will come with a large shopping basket that is ideal to carry all of your day-to-day essentials like nappies and snacks. Check that the basket is accessible when the seat of the pushchair reclines and is large enough to hold your regular purchases. Also, you should consider the brakes. A single pedal brake that locks both rear wheels will ensure that the pushchair remains stable even when stationary.

The main difference between a pushchair and a pram is that a pram features a lie-flat seat which is suitable from birth. A pushchair, on other hand, comes with an adjustable seat unit which can be used in a variety of reclining positions, from fully flat to sitting upright, so it is suitable for older infants and toddlers.

A variety of pushchairs are suitable to be used from birth, provided they come with an infant car seat or carrycot that can be connected. Some models even come with a second seat attachment, which means you could turn your pushchair into a twin or tandem pushchair for children who are close in age. Easy to clean

A pushchair's ability to be easily cleaned is one of its most significant features. Spillages, food residues and mould are all common in a pushchair. It is important to clean it regularly. You should give your child an easy wipe after each use and wash it thoroughly once a week.

Before you begin cleaning your pushchair, it is essential to clean off any loose dirt, crumbs or debris. You can either employ a handheld vacuum with a flexible nozzle or a standard household one however, you must go into all crevices and corners.

After you've done this, you're now able to begin washing the fabric components of your stroller. The washing instructions may differ depending on the manufacturer, but it's generally safe to use a gentle baby-safe soap with warm water. You can use an old toothbrush to get rid of dirt and grime from difficult-to-reach areas or creases.

It is also important to clean the frame and wheels regularly. You can use a hose to get rid of any sand or mud that is wet. You should also wash the wheels regularly using an broomstick, and warm soapy water.

Use disinfecting wipes to clean the hard plastic parts of your pushchair, like the frame and handles. Be sure to follow the contact time instructions on the packaging of the product to ensure a thorough clean.
